Outline of NGB's Club accreditation scheme

Wing AttackEngland Netball’s Club Action Planning Scheme (CAPS) is an accreditation scheme that offers guidelines to help clubs provide the right environment for their members. It is directly linked to Sport England’s Clubmark scheme and it’s all about good practice in the development of players, coaches and umpires at all levels.

CAPS takes accepted sports development ideas and makes them flexible enough to fit in with club’s current activities

In line with the Clubmark award, CAPS focuses on four key areas that impact Netball clubs:

  • Duty of Care and Child Protection,
  • Coaching and Competition,
  • Club Management/ Administration,
  • Sports Equity and Ethics.

CAPS offers Bronze, Silver and Gold levels of achievement, highlighting further development work whilst ensuring that all clubs have the chance to shine.
